MACON, Ga. (May 6, 2014) – Capping a record-breaking senior campaign, ETSU Softball's Katie Wolff (La Grange, Texas) has been named to the All-Atlantic Sun First Team.

This season, Wolff set ETSU single-season records for batting average (.394), on-base percentage (.439), and doubles (12) to help lead the Buccaneers to seven Atlantic Sun victories, the program's most since 2008.

The senior slugger split time this season at first base, the designated player position, and on the mound for the Bucs.

Wolff finishes her ETSU playing career ranking in the ETSU Top 20 for career runs scores, hits, RBI, batting average, and on-base percentage.

The La Grange, Texas, native becomes the first ETSU player to be named to the First Team since 2010 when Sam Lower garnered first-team honors.
